Transaction 72024700ac26752431791c78db330713d24442fa348d434a93bb383a8130328f
2 Input
2 Outputs
- 72024700ac26752431791c78db330713d24442fa348d434a93bb383a8130328f:0
- 72024700ac26752431791c78db330713d24442fa348d434a93bb383a8130328f:1
value 5462966
address 16SrGoM32snLff9RnPkedSSg1woj1QrLY9
value 25328
address 1GceJfsoTTosPzGpR9ZzfraWMNmNmeQ4DT